Introduction to the Importance of Data Backup and Storage

Data backup and storage are critical components of any security protocol, ensuring that essential information remains intact and retrievable. In an age where digital threats, hardware failures, and accidental deletions are common, having reliable backups safeguards valuable data from permanent loss. Businesses and individuals alike depend on secure storage solutions to maintain their digital integrity.

Effective data backup methods serve as a fail-safe against unforeseen events. Regular backups mitigate risks posed by ransomware attacks, human errors, or natural disasters. Additionally, robust storage practices ensure that data is organised, easily accessible, and resistant to corruption.

Modern systems offer diverse solutions like cloud storage, external drives, and automated backups. Employing a proper strategy requires understanding potential risks, scalability options, and convenience factors. Furthermore, it helps in complying with legal and regulatory standards for data management.

This vital practice emphasises preparedness, reinforcing that data is not just stored but also recoverable when needed.

What to Look for in a Reliable Backup Solution

When evaluating a dependable backup solution, several key aspects require attention to ensure robust security and functionality:

  • Automation: A reliable system should support automated backups to reduce human error and save time.
  • Versioning: Check if it saves multiple file versions to guard against unintended overwrites.
  • Data Encryption: Look for end-to-end encryption to protect data during transfer and storage.
  • Scalability: Ensure the solution can grow alongside increasing data needs without performance issues.
  • Compatibility: Verify it works seamlessly with existing operating systems and applications.
  • Disaster Recovery Options: Prioritise solutions offering quick restoration to minimise downtime after incidents.
  • Support Services: Availability of reliable customer support for troubleshooting and guidance is vital.

Cloud-Based Backup Solutions: Convenience and Accessibility

Cloud-based backup solutions offer a seamless way to store essential data with minimal effort, providing unmatched convenience. These services allow users to store files off-site, reducing risks associated with physical hardware failures or localised disasters such as fires or floods. Accessibility is another strong advantage, enabling users to retrieve data from any internet-connected device.

Key features to consider include:

  • Automated Backups: Users can schedule backups to run automatically, minimising manual intervention.
  • Scalability: Cloud storage can easily scale to accommodate growing data needs.
  • Encryption: Many providers ensure data is encrypted during transfer and at rest for added security.
  • Versioning: Options to store multiple file versions help recover from accidental overwrites or deletions.

Selecting a reliable provider ensures data remains protected and easily accessible.

External Hard Drives: A Classic Yet Reliable Option

External hard drives have long been a staple for data storage and remain a dependable choice for both individuals and businesses. These devices are available in various storage capacities, from a few hundred gigabytes to several terabytes, allowing users to back up everything from essential documents to large multimedia files.

Key benefits include their portability, as they can be easily carried and connected to different devices via USB or other interfaces. Additionally, they do not rely on an internet connection, making them a viable offline solution for data security.

For better durability, users can choose models with solid-state drives (SSD), which are more resistant to physical damage than traditional spinning hard drives. However, regular maintenance, such as safely ejecting the drive, is crucial to prevent data corruption.

Network Attached Storage (NAS): The Perfect Choice for Homes and Small Businesses

Network Attached Storage (NAS) provides a centralised solution for storing, managing, and accessing data seamlessly. Designed to cater to both homes and small businesses, NAS offers significant advantages over traditional storage methods.

Key Benefits of NAS:

  • Centralised Access: All users on the network can access files anytime, eliminating the need for individual storage devices.
  • Data Redundancy: RAID configurations ensure data protection, minimising risks of data loss.
  • Remote Accessibility: Files can be securely accessed from anywhere with an internet connection.
  • Scalability: NAS systems are easily expandable to accommodate growing storage needs.

NAS is an ideal choice for those seeking secure, scalable, and efficient data storage, whether for personal use or business operations.

Hybrid Backup Solutions: Combining the Best of Local and Cloud Storage

Hybrid backup solutions deliver the reliability of local storage paired with the versatility of cloud storage. By diversifying backup locations, organisations minimise the risk of data loss from hardware failures or online threats. Local backups offer faster recovery times and remain accessible during internet outages. On the other hand, cloud storage provides offsite security against disasters like fire or theft while ensuring scalability and remote accessibility.

Key benefits include:

  • Enhanced redundancy: Safeguarding data in two separate locations.
  • Cost-efficient scalability: Expanding cloud storage as needs evolve.
  • Streamlined access: Remote availability alongside local speed.

This approach balances immediate recovery needs with long-term security.

Encryption and Security Features to Consider in Backup Systems

When evaluating backup systems, robust encryption is essential to protect sensitive data from unauthorised access. End-to-end encryption ensures that data remains secure during transmission and storage. AES-256 encryption is widely regarded as an industry standard for its high level of security.

Look for backup systems offering multi-factor authentication (MFA) to add an extra layer of protection to user accounts. Additionally, consider systems supporting zero-knowledge encryption, where only users hold the decryption keys, ensuring that providers cannot access stored data.

Check for compliance certifications, such as GDPR or ISO 27001, to ensure adherence to data protection regulations. Regular security audits and vulnerability assessments further reinforce trust in the system's security measures.

Automation and Scheduling: Ensuring Regular Data Backups

Regular data backups are critical to protect against data loss, and automation can streamline this process effectively. Automated backup systems eliminate the risk of forgetting manual backups, ensuring consistency and reliability. Organisations and individuals should use scheduling features within backup software to define specific times and frequencies for backups.

Key considerations include:

  • Frequency: Schedule backups daily, weekly, or hourly based on data sensitivity.
  • Storage Options: Automate backups to multiple locations, such as cloud storage and an external drive.
  • Alerts and Logs: Enable notifications and maintain logs for monitoring successful backups.

By combining automation with carefully planned schedules, critical data remains securely backed up without constant manual intervention.

Scalability and Future-Proofing Your Storage System

Scalability is crucial for addressing growing storage demands without frequent overhauls. Organisations should select systems capable of expanding with minimal disruptions. Cloud-based options often provide dynamic scalability by allowing users to upgrade storage capacity as needed, avoiding underutilisation or excessive costs.

Future-proofing storage systems involves adopting technologies compatible with evolving standards. Look for solutions supporting advanced formats like NVMe or hybrid setups combining SSDs and HDDs. Compatibility with AI or machine learning-driven analytics can also optimise storage use while enhancing performance.

Consider redundancy measures such as RAID configurations. Regularly assess hardware lifecycles and software updates to ensure longevity, improving reliability while accommodating future data needs effectively.

Final Thoughts: Choosing the Right Backup and Storage Solution for Your Needs

Selecting the ideal backup and storage solution depends on several factors, including the type of data, frequency of access, and security requirements. Data sensitivity should influence whether cloud-based or physical storage is prioritised, as cloud services often offer encryption, while local drives provide direct control. For larger organisations, hybrid systems combining local and cloud backup may be beneficial due to scalability.

Consider the cost-to-benefit ratio, assessing subscription fees for cloud services against hardware costs for external drives or servers. User accessibility matters too; intuitive systems can minimise errors. Reviewing disaster recovery speed ensures downtime is mitigated during critical failures, enhancing overall security.
